Just How Moisture Meters Work





Moisture meters run by gauging the electric conductivity or capacitance of materials to figure out the wetness web content present. These meters are very useful tools throughout different markets, consisting of woodworking, construction, and farming. By making use of various approaches such as pin-type or pinless modern technology, moisture meters offer accurate analyses that assist specialists make educated choices.


Pin-type dampness meters work by placing the sharp pins right into the material being tested. On the various other hand, pinless moisture meters use electro-magnetic signals to scan a bigger location without creating any kind of damages to the product's surface area.


Regardless of the method made use of, dampness meters play a vital duty in avoiding concerns such as mold and mildew growth, structural damage, or product issues triggered by excess wetness. Understanding just how these meters job is vital for guaranteeing the quality and honesty of materials in various applications.


Kinds of Moisture Meters





Provided the crucial function moisture meters play in numerous industries, it is vital to comprehend the different kinds available to specialists for precisely assessing wetness levels - Moisture Meter. There are mostly two main kinds of wetness meters: pinless and pin-type wetness meters

Pin-type wetness meters utilize 2 pins that are placed into the product being checked to measure the electric resistance in between them. This method is generally utilized for wood, drywall, and various other building products. Pin-type meters offer precise analyses at particular midsts, making them suitable for identifying dampness gradients.


On the various other hand, pinless wetness meters utilize electromagnetic sensing unit plates to scan a bigger location of the material without creating any type of damages. This type is ideal for promptly scanning big locations and is typically made use of for flooring, wall surfaces, and ceilings. Pinless meters are convenient for taking analyses on completed surfaces without leaving any kind of visible marks.


Both kinds of wetness meters have their benefits and are chosen based upon the details demands of the work at hand. Comprehending the distinctions between these types is important for professionals to make precise dampness assessments.


Applications Across Industries



With varied functionalities, wetness meters discover prevalent application across different markets, assisting professionals in ensuring optimal problems for frameworks and materials. In the farming field, moisture meters are vital for identifying the moisture material in grains, seeds, and hay, making sure quality assurance and preventing mold growth. Building specialists depend on moisture meters to evaluate the moisture levels in building materials like drywall, concrete, and timber, which is critical for maintaining architectural honesty and preventing issues like rot or mold. The flooring market uses wetness meters to determine the moisture content in subfloors before installing various flooring, protecting against pricey problems as a result of excess dampness. In the food sector, dampness meters are used to monitor and regulate moisture degrees in products such as grains, nuts, and dried out fruits to keep freshness and quality. Furthermore, dampness meters play a vital duty in the repair and damage assessment sector by assisting professionals address and recognize water damages in buildings without delay. Across these diverse markets, moisture meters are indispensable devices for guaranteeing the quality, safety and security, and durability of numerous products and items.


Tips for Making Use Of Dampness Meters



Utilize the wetness meter's calibration setups to ensure precise analyses when gauging the moisture material in different products. Calibration is vital for the correct performance of a moisture meter. Before each use, it is a good idea to examine and readjust the calibration setups according to the specific material being tested. Additionally, see to it the meter is established to the appropriate moisture range for the material you are determining to get the most exact outcomes.


When using a pin-type moisture meter, insert the pins to the appropriate deepness advised for the product being evaluated. This guarantees that the moisture readings are taken from the correct deepness within the product, supplying a much more precise representation of its dampness material. For pinless wetness meters, remember to keep appropriate contact with the product's surface area to get reliable readings.

Maintenance and Calibration



To make certain the accuracy of moisture web content measurements, routine upkeep and calibration of the dampness meter are vital actions in its why not try this out proper functioning. Maintenance includes maintaining the moisture meter clean and complimentary from particles that might affect its analyses. It is very important to adhere to the manufacturer's guidelines for cleaning up to stop damage to the gadget. Furthermore, routine calibration is essential to validate the accuracy of the readings. Calibration adjusts the moisture meter to guarantee that it supplies regular and trusted results.


Calibration must be performed occasionally, specifically if the wetness meter is made use of frequently or in vital applications where precise dimensions are called for. By adjusting the wetness and keeping meter regularly, customers can trust the accuracy of the wetness material dimensions gotten.
